📝 Description: The Ancient Art of Tasseography

Learn the ancient art of tasseography and how to read tea leaves and coffee grounds. This essential book covers the history of tea leaf and coffee cup reading, intuition, setting the intention, and preparation. Along with a dictionary of symbols, tea meditation, recipes, and advice on journaling, The Ancient Art of Tasseography is your complete guide.

Holmes presents a welcoming entry point into tasseography, offering a well-organized resource that balances historical appreciation with actionable advice. The inclusion of recipes and meditative exercises adds tangible value for those seeking a holistic approach to divination. However, this text is not suited for the academic historian or the skeptical rationalist, as it operates entirely within the framework of spiritual belief rather than empirical analysis. Readers expecting complex theoretical debates or rigorous archaeological evidence will find the content too accessible and subjective. It is best appreciated by those already inclined toward intuitive practices who desire a practical manual rather than a scholarly critique.

📜 Historical context

Tasseography, or the reading of tea leaves and coffee grounds, extends an ancient lineage of scrying and prophecy. It taps into the universal human desire to understand the future and gain insight, echoing practices from various cultures that interpret natural formations, from cloud patterns to animal entrails, as messages from the cosmos.
